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 180°C (360°F).
- Prick each sweet potato several times with a fork and roast in the oven for about 60 minutes until soft.
- Allow the sweet potatoes to cool for 10 minutes, then peel and mash in a bowl. Mix in 180g of flour until a smooth dough forms.
- On a floured surface, roll the dough into thick ropes and cut into small squares. Use a fork to create ridges on each piece.
- Boil a large pot of salted water and cook the gnocchi for 2-3 minutes, until they float to the surface.
- Remove the gnocchi with a slotted spoon, drain on a paper towel-lined plate, and serve with a sauce of your choice.

Notes
Choose firm, unblemished sweet potatoes for best results. Knead the dough gently to avoid toughness. Store cooled gnocchi in the fridge for up to 3 days.
